Natural Language Processing (NLP): This is the magic behind a chatbot understanding what you say. NLP allows the chatbot to analyze your messages, identify keywords and phrases, and extract meaning from your questions or requests.
Conversational AI: This takes NLP a step further. Conversational AI enables the chatbot to not only understand your words but also respond in a way that simulates a natural conversation. This includes using appropriate tone, context, and even humor (depending on the chatbot's design).
Decision Trees and Flowcharts: These act as a roadmap for the chatbot's conversation. They define the different paths a conversation can take based on user input. This ensures the chatbot can navigate the discussion and provide relevant responses.

Chatbots have rapidly transformed from a novelty to a near-necessity for businesses and organizations. Their ability to hold conversations, answer questions, and automate tasks makes them valuable tools across various sectors. Here's why chatbots are becoming increasingly important:
- Increased Efficiency and Cost Savings: Chatbots can automate repetitive tasks such as scheduling appointments, collecting basic information, and qualifying leads. This frees up human employees to focus on more complex issues and strategic work, leading to increased efficiency and cost savings.
- Improved Lead Generation and Sales: Chatbots can engage website visitors, answer product inquiries, and qualify leads. They can even personalize product recommendations and upsell relevant services, boosting sales potential.
- Data Collection and Insights: Chatbot interactions generate valuable data about customer behavior, preferences, and pain points. This data can be analyzed to improve customer service, product development, and marketing strategies.
- Global Reach and Accessibility: Chatbots can break down language barriers and cater to a global audience. They can translate conversations in real-time, making information and services accessible to a wider range of users.
- Personalized Interactions: Chatbots can personalize interactions based on user data and past conversations. This can create a more engaging and relevant experience for each customer.
- Always-Learning Technology: Advanced chatbots leverage machine learning to continuously learn and improve. They can adapt their responses based on past interactions and become more adept at understanding user needs.
